Transaction 70066fd01d755ed121b872ff91701f7d9a1c032f55f4a25482afa8054cb0caf4

337 Input
1 Outputs
  • 70066fd01d755ed121b872ff91701f7d9a1c032f55f4a25482afa8054cb0caf4:0
  • value  112109540
    address  1CJ8ykurz18LhB6AktE2GZP3tVuzEgsrin